UP-GRADATION OF THE POST OF COMPUTER OFFICIALS / OFFICERS

Government of Sindh, Finance Department, Finance Secretary approved the up-gradation of the posts of Computer Operator / Data Entry Operator and Data Procession Officer.

The matter of up-gradation of the posts of Computer operator /Data Entry Operator and Data Processing Officer BPS-7/8, 11/12 & BPS-16 was earlier placed before the Provincial Cabinet in its meeting dated 25-04-2019 and the Cabinet decided to constitute a Committee comprising of the following members to deliberate upon different aspects of the subject matter including financial implications, service structure, potential amendments in rules, comparison with other provinces and suggestions regarding introduction of uniform policy in all departments. SGA&CD accordingly notified vide its Notification No. SOVI(SGA&CD)/13-27/2019 dated 6.05.2019 (Annexure:1): -

Accordingly, meeting of the Committee was held under the Chairmanship of Hon'ble Minister for Health and Population Department on 16.09.2019 and it has unanimously been recommended by the said Committee that the IT personnel may be upgraded as proposed by Finance Department on the pattern of Punjab Government. The IT individuals after up-gradation of their posts will be given training to enhance their capacity building. This entails financial implication of Rs. 458.752 million vide minutes of the Committee placed at (Annexure-II).

A Summary for Chief Minister Sindh was initiated for placing the matter Before the Provincial Cabinet and The Honourable Chief Minister Sindh has been pleased to approve the same (Annexure-III).

On the recommendations of the Committee, the proposed up-gradation is as under:
  • Computer Operator (BS-7/8) with Intermediate (2nd Division) + 6 Months Training in MS Office with 40 wpm speed on Computer typing  to BS-12 as Junior Computer Operator 
  • Computer Operator / Data Entry Operator (BS-11/12) with Graduation + 6 Months Training in MS Office / BCS 3/4 years Degree (2nd Division) having three years experience or equivalent degree to BS-16 as Senior Computer Operator
  • Computer Operator / Data Processing Officer (BS-16) Graduation + 6 Months training in MS Office / BCS Degree (2nd Division) + three years' Experience as Computer Operator / Senior Computer Operator / Data Processing Officer (BS-16) and in case of fresh appointment prescribed qualification would be MCS / MS (IT)/B.E (Computer Systems) etc from HEC recognized University to BS-17 as Senior Data Processing Officer.

Accordingly, the matter is placed before the Provincial Cabinet for approval of the recommendations of the Committee regarding up-gradation of the posts of Computer Operator / Data Entry Operator and Data Processing Officer BPS-7/8, 11/12 and BPS-16 respectively, as mentioned above.
